2012 Dyna Switchback
I came from a Nightster in July, and couldn't be happier. The Sporty was fun for zipping around locally, but anything more than that was more work than pleasure. 6th gear is a huge plus. At 80 she chugs along at 3,000rpm's. The ride is obviously much smoother. One of my favorite features so far has been the lockable hard bags. Now I can keep my rain gear on board all the time, and I don't have to wear a backpack anymore! The one thing I wish they would have done was put a heel toe shifter on, but I'm sure something will pop up eventually. I was originally set on the Fatbob, but I kept telling myself the hard bags and floorboards were a huge advantage for distance riding. I know I made the right choice!
